Fair play for Crookfur primary

All is fair (trade) at Crookfur primary this term, thanks to the school’s fair trade action team.

The pupils have set up their own group in order to spread the word on fair trade products – and how they provide for some of the poorest people in the world – throughout the East Renfrewshire community.

The action team has raised £464.50 so far from setting up stalls before and after school concerts, and are now working their way towards a series of events for Fair Trade Fortnight, running February 25 until March 10.
